Recruitment Coordinator | CBD (Southbank) | Consultancy Firm | Full Time

**Your new company**
This international search firms specialises in connecting international talent with Australian employers.
Due to strategic growth in the market, there exists a newly created job for a Recruitment Coordinator to join their successful team.

**Your new role**
Working part of a team who are experts in the recruitment of hospitality staff, you will work with international and domestic clients to provide staffing solutions.
Duties will include:

- Coordinate the interview process, reference checking, etc.

**What you'll need to succeed**
- Outstanding writing and verbal communication skills.
- Experience in recruitment administration and coordination.
- Ideally experience in the hospitality sector or recruiting in the hospitality sector.

**What you'll get in return**
- In house training and development.
- Work/Life Balance.
- Highly supportive management team.
- Opportunity to work in a highly varied recruitment position with multiple employers/clients from the hospitality industry.
